Over hundreds of hands, the difference between these two approaches is significant.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Three types of odds you need to understand:<\/b><\/p>\n<table class=\" table table-bordered\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Type<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>What It Means<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Hand Odds<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Probability of completing your hand<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Pot Odds<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Ratio of pot size to the cost of calling<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Implied Odds<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Potential future winnings if you complete your hand<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h2>Understanding Poker Outs Before Calculating Poker Odds | Golden444<\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Before you can calculate poker odds, you need to understand outs. An out is any card remaining in the deck that can improve your hand to a winning hand.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Example:<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">You hold two hearts. The flop shows two more hearts. You need one more heart to complete a flush. There are 13 hearts in a deck. You have 2 in your hand. 2 are on the board. That leaves 9 hearts remaining in the deck.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Your outs = 9<\/b><\/p>\n<table class=\" table table-bordered\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Hand You Are Chasing<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>Number of Outs<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Flush draw<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">9 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Open-ended straight draw<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">8 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Two overcards<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">6 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Gutshot straight draw<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">4 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">One overcard<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">3 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Pocket pair to three of a kind<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">2 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h2><b>How to Calculate Poker Odds Using the Rule of 2 and 4\u00a0<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The rule of 2 and 4 is the fastest way to calculate poker odds at the table. No calculator needed. No complex math.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Here is how it works:<\/b><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">After the flop &#8211; two cards still to come &#8211; multiply your outs by <\/span><b>4<\/b><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">After the turn &#8211; one card still to come &#8211; multiply your outs by <\/span><b>2<\/b><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This gives you your approximate percentage chance of completing your hand.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Example &#8211; Flush Draw After the Flop:<\/b><\/h3>\n<table class=\" table table-bordered\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Calculation<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>Result<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">9<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Cards still to come<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">2 &#8211; flop stage<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Calculation<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">9 \u00d7 4<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Approximate winning chance<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">36 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h3><b>Example &#8211; Flush Draw After the Turn:<\/b><\/h3>\n<table class=\" table table-bordered\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Calculation<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>Result<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">9<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Cards still to come<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">1 &#8211; turn stage<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Calculation<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">9 \u00d7 2<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Approximate winning chance<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">18 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h3><b>Poker Odds Chart for Common Drawing Hands\u00a0<\/b><\/h3>\n<table class=\" table table-bordered\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Outs<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>After Flop &#8211; 2 Cards to Come<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>After Turn &#8211; 1 Card to Come<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">2 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">8 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">4 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">4 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">16 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">8 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">6 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">24 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">12 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">8 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">32 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">16 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">9 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">36 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">18 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">10 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">40 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">20 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">12 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">48 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">24 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">15 outs<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">60 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">30 percent<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Save this table. It covers the most common situations you will face at any poker table.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>How Pot Odds Help You Make Better Poker Decisions | Golden444<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Knowing your hand odds is only half the equation. Pot odds tell you whether calling a bet is mathematically profitable based on the size of the pot.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>How to calculate pot odds:<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Pot odds = Size of the pot divided by the cost of your call<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>Example:<\/b><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Pot size &#8211; \u20b91000<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Your opponent bets \u20b9200<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Total pot &#8211; \u20b91200<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Your call &#8211; \u20b9200<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Pot odds &#8211; 1200 to 200 &#8211; simplified to 6 to 1<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>How to use pot odds:<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Convert your hand odds to a ratio and compare them to the pot odds.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If your pot odds are better than your hand odds, calling is profitable.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><br \/>\n<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> If your hand odds are worse than your pot odds, folding is the correct decision.<\/span><\/p>\n<table class=\" table table-bordered\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Pot Odds<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>Hand Odds<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>Decision<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">6 to 1<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">4 to 1<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Call &#8211; pot odds are better<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">3 to 1<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">5 to 1<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Fold &#8211; hand odds are worse<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">5 to 1<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">5 to 1<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Break-even &#8211; depends on implied odds<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h2><b>Understanding Implied Odds in Poker\u00a0<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Implied odds go one step beyond pot odds. They account for the additional money you can win from your opponent if you complete your hand.<\/span><\/p>\n<h3><b>When implied odds matter:<\/b><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">You have a strong draw flush or straight<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Your opponent has a large stack<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The pot is small but future bets could be large<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><b>Implied Odds Example:<\/b><\/h3>\n<table class=\" table table-bordered\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Situation<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>Detail<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Current pot<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u20b9500<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Cost to call<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u20b9200<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Pot odds<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">2.5 to 1<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Your flush draw odds<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">4 to 1 against<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Pot odds do not justify call<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u2014<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Opponent stack remaining<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u20b92000<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Estimated future winnings if you hit<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u20b9800<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Implied pot<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u20b91300<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Implied odds<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">6.5 to 1 &#8211; now profitable<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h3><b>Simple rule for beginners:<\/b><\/h3>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If pot odds do not justify a call but your hand is very strong implied odds may make calling correct.
